Papa Johns

Papa John's International, Inc., d/b/a Papa Johns, is an American pizza restaurant chain. It is the fourth largest pizza delivery restaurant chain in the United States, with headquarters in Louisville, Kentucky and Atlanta, Georgia metropolitan areas. Papa John's global presence has reached over 5,500 locations in 49 countries and territories; and is currently the world's third-largest pizza delivery company.

Read more in the app

Papa Johns delivers 'space-flavored' pizza inspired by flown chorizo